☕ Um Café no Bellacosa Mainframe — z/OS 1.11: o sistema operacional que trouxe o mainframe para a era da automação e integração inteligente
🕰️ Ano de lançamento
O IBM z/OS 1.11 foi lançado em setembro de 2009, acompanhando o System z10 e já projetado para explorar os novos recursos do futuro zEnterprise z196.
Essa versão marcou o início de uma nova filosofia da IBM: transformar o mainframe em uma plataforma de nuvem corporativa, com automação, padronização e serviços integrados.
Se o z/OS 1.9 foi o cérebro que aprendeu a se ajustar, o 1.11 foi o que começou a conversar com o mundo — do batch ao web service, do COBOL ao Java.
⚙️ Introdução técnica
O z/OS 1.11 foi uma das versões mais importantes na linha evolutiva do sistema operacional da IBM.
Seu foco foi automação, integração e modernização de workloads, incluindo:
-
Melhorias em Parallel Sysplex, WLM e Sysplex Distributor;
-
Suporte estendido para Java 6 e J2EE workloads;
-
Inovação com o z/OS Management Facility (z/OSMF) — a primeira interface web administrativa nativa;
-
Preparação do sistema para ambientes de nuvem privada com gerenciamento centralizado.
Foi o primeiro passo concreto rumo ao conceito de z/OS como um serviço, uma base sólida para DevOps e administração simplificada.
🧠 Avanços na memória e arquitetura
O z/OS 1.11 consolidou o uso inteligente da memória com diversas melhorias:
-
Suporte ampliado ao 64-bit Real Memory (memória física acima de 2 TB nos novos mainframes);
-
Introdução de Large Memory Workload Management, otimizando o balanceamento entre LPARs e processadores zIIP/zAAP;
-
Novo modelo de páginas grandes (1MB e 2GB) — reduzindo TLB misses e melhorando performance para Java, DB2 e IMS;
-
HiperDispatch aprimorado, permitindo que o sistema entenda afinidade entre processadores e cache L3 — essencial no z10.
Esses avanços permitiram que o z/OS 1.11 alcançasse níveis inéditos de throughput e paralelismo, mantendo latência mínima mesmo sob carga mista (CICS, batch e WebSphere simultaneamente).
🧩 Aplicativos internos e softwares embarcados
O ecossistema do z/OS 1.11 foi um verdadeiro salto de modernização.
Alguns destaques:
-
z/OS Management Facility (z/OSMF):
Primeira interface web oficial para administração do sistema, com painéis para automação, diagnóstico, configuração e gerenciamento de políticas WLM.
Simplificou tarefas antes realizadas apenas via TSO/ISPF. -
RACF (Security Server):
Suporte a Kerberos, LDAPv3 aprimorado, autenticação forte e integração com certificados X.509 e tokens digitais.
Introduziu segurança contextual (baseada em aplicação e identidade). -
DFSMS:
Recursos de automated data tiering e policy management que ajustam classes de armazenamento automaticamente conforme o uso.
O sistema agora entende se um dataset é “quente” (muito acessado) ou “frio”. -
JES2/JES3:
Novas funções de checkpoint automático, otimização de spool e integração direta com WLM.
Suporte a batch pipes aprimorado — essencial em grandes ambientes financeiros. -
RMF (Resource Measurement Facility):
Painéis gráficos via z/OSMF e suporte a monitoramento em tempo real.
Agora o RMF conversa com o WLM, ajudando a ajustar prioridades de forma preditiva. -
UNIX System Services (USS):
Suporte a NFSv4, POSIX Threads 2008, 64-bit shared libraries e novas APIs para Java e CICS TS 4.1.
O USS finalmente se torna um “Unix de verdade” dentro do z/OS.
🔬 Instruções de máquina e PR/SM
Com o System z10, o z/OS 1.11 pôde explorar um conjunto poderoso de novas instruções:
-
Decimal Floating Point (DFP) — um divisor de águas para cargas financeiras e científicas, agora executadas nativamente em hardware.
-
Improved Branch Prediction e Pipeline Control, otimizando ciclos por instrução.
-
Criptografia CPACF v3 com suporte a SHA-2 e AES-256 de alta velocidade.
-
Hardware-based time synchronization (STCKE) — precisão de microssegundos entre LPARs.
No firmware, o PR/SM ganhou refinamentos que transformaram a administração:
-
Dynamic Logical Processor Management, permitindo ligar/desligar CPUs sem IPL;
-
Group Capacity Capping Inteligente, ajustando limites conforme a carga;
-
HiperDispatch Awareness — o PR/SM entende quais threads se beneficiam de caches próximos, reduzindo cross-LPAR latency.
Essas mudanças deram ao z/OS 1.11 o status de sistema operacional consciente de hardware, capaz de usar cada ciclo de CPU de forma estratégica.
🧮 Créditos de CPU e virtualização
O z/OS 1.11 trouxe um dos avanços mais finos em gerenciamento de CPU:
-
O WLM (Workload Manager) foi redesenhado para funcionar com HiperDispatch e PR/SM inteligente.
-
Créditos de CPU dinâmicos agora são realocados em tempo real com base em service classes e goals.
-
Integração mais profunda com zAAPs e zIIPs, permitindo que workloads Java e DB2 usem processadores especializados sem penalizar o uso geral.
-
Introdução do Soft Capping Dinâmico 2.0 — controle fino de MIPS por LPAR com base em carga real, não apenas limite estático.
Esse conjunto de recursos transformou o z/OS 1.11 em um ambiente de computação previsível, otimizado e autocorretivo.
🧭 Curiosidades e bastidores
-
O projeto interno da IBM foi apelidado de “Aurora”, simbolizando o nascer de uma nova era de gerenciamento visual e automação.
-
O z/OS 1.11 foi o primeiro sistema operacional IBM com interface web embarcada (z/OSMF) — um marco histórico.
-
Também foi a primeira versão compatível nativamente com Java 6, o que revolucionou o uso do WebSphere Application Server no mainframe.
-
O RMF começou a gerar dados exportáveis via XML e HTTP, prenúncio da integração com ferramentas de monitoramento modernas.
☕ Dica Bellacosa Mainframe
Quer ver o z/OS conversar com o operador?
O z/OSMF é o ponto de virada. Se você nunca testou, vale rodar em um zPDT ou zD&T.
Além disso, o z/OS 1.11 é excelente para quem quer entender a transição do mainframe clássico (verde e 3270) para o mundo Web, API e automação.
📜 Resumo técnico rápido
| Item | Descrição |
|---|---|
| Versão | z/OS 1.11 |
| Ano de lançamento | 2009 |
| Hardware principal | IBM System z10 / início do z196 |
| Arquitetura | z/Architecture (64-bit total) |
| PR/SM | Dynamic LPAR, HiperDispatch, Soft Capping 2.0 |
| Instruções novas | Decimal Floating Point, SHA-2, AES-256 |
| WLM | HiperDispatch-aware, credit realocation em tempo real |
| Segurança | RACF com Kerberos e autenticação forte |
| Rede | NFSv4, IPv6, IPsec e QoS avançado |
| Curiosidade | Primeira versão com z/OSMF (interface web nativa) |
💬 “O z/OS 1.11 não apenas gerenciava o mainframe — ele aprendeu a mostrá-lo ao mundo.”